Danobatgroup Railways Open House to show wheelset production line

Danobatgroup Railways, part of the Spanish Danobat Group, a machine tool design and manufacture activity, is to hold an Open House this month, following its official opening last September.

The new company is part of the Danobat Group's strategy to target niche sectors, offering full turnkey production systems. Danobatgroup Railways is involved in projects worldwide and is currently at the assembly stage of a fully automatic flexible line for rolling stock components (axles, wheels and wheelsets). This production line, which is capable of producing 50,000 wheelsets per year, will be shown during the Open House, which is to be held from 15-30 January, at the company's Bergara, Spain, location. The production line is completely automatic, from the insertion of the forging code of the axle on the central PC, to the bearing mounting of the wheelset.
